If you don't want attention from cops, I suggest staying away from bright reds and yellows and oranges and bright greens and such. I frequently get(well, got...I haven't been driving for 2+ months) pulled over for things such as pulling into the far lane instead of the close one, driving four over the speed limit in a thirty, etc.
Also, keep in mind that if you get a tri coat paint with pearl in it or something fancy, it's going to be a major pain and cost a lot to get any future bodywork done, as it's very tough to match the existing paint. I destroyed my front end pretty good through a couple incidents, and it's going to cost me a lot to get it repainted. ![]() Also, you might want to consider getting your interior panels professionally painted the same color as the car when your car is being painted.
